
Intro to Apple Business
Apple Business is a unified platform designed to empower organizations with seamless device management, robust support, secure cloud storage, and powerful tools to enhance customer engagement and brand presence across Apple’s ecosystem. It combines the capabilities previously found in Apple Business Manager, Apple Business Essentials, and Apple Business Connect into a single, comprehensive offering, catering to both your internal operational needs and your external customer-facing strategies.
Whether your organization uses iPhone, iPad, Mac, Apple TV, Apple Vision Pro, or Apple Watch, Apple Business provides the tools to manage your devices, content, and brand identity effectively.
Note: Not all features are available in every country or region.

Automated Device Enrollment
Streamline initial setup without touching or preparing devices beforehand. You can automatically enroll devices in the built-in or third-party device management service of choice, as long as you add devices to your organization at the time of purchase—from Apple, an Apple Authorized Reseller, an authorized cellular carrier, or through Apple Configurator. Managed Apple Accounts
Get apps and books licenses in volume and assign, install, and update them wirelessly to devices or users. You retain full ownership and control of apps you buy, and can revoke and reassign apps to different devices and users—in any country where that app is available from the App Store. Create and manage Apple Accounts for your employees at scale. You can use Managed Apple Accounts for account-driven enrollment workflows, and keep organizational data separate from personal data with robust management controls. With identity and access management, you can define what services are available to employees, and custom roles let you create accounts with the permissions you need to manage Apple Business. See Intro to Managed Apple Accounts.
By integrating with your existing identity provider’s (IdP) environment, you can provide Managed Apple Accounts to users using their existing organization credentials—for example, Google Workspace, Microsoft Entra ID, or your IdP. You can then sync user accounts. See Intro to federated authentication.

iCloud storage
Secure your business data and help maintain employee privacy with additional iCloud storage for your Managed Apple Accounts. This keeps storage, backup, and collaboration simple and secure. Plans include customizable storage with up to 2 TB per employee, allowing employees to access their documents and data wherever they are, and unlock seamless collaboration when they need it. Customize place cards
Your place card is an extension of a physical location and appears in many Apple apps, from Maps to Siri to Calendar, Messages, and Spotlight searches. You can also get data about how your business is being viewed in Maps.
Create showcases
A showcase is a module on the place card that allows you to highlight new items, deals or sales, or other promotional content and include a call to action for a customer to select.
